Abstract

 印刷適性に優れ、転写効率に優れた液圧転写印刷用ベースフィルムおよびそれを用いた液圧転写方法を提供する。本発明は、ポリビニルアルコール系フィルムを含む液圧転写印刷用ベースフィルムであって、該フィルムを液面に浮かべてから25秒後のカール面積率が30%以下である液圧転写印刷用ベースフィルムである。そして、これを連続方式、あるいはバッチ方式による液圧転写方法に供する。
